I am searching for anyone acquainted with the Pye family who might have an old Bible or records in their possession. My grandfather was Jesse Lacy Pye born in 1865 who immigrated to Boston with a young family around 1900. He owned a Bible that had every birth, marriage and death listed in it. However, the family was living in Chelsea, MA at the time of the Chelsea fire in 1908 and they lost everything including the Bible. I am trying to determine the parentage of Blanche Pye who was in Carbonear by 1780 (possibly earlier)
and the man she married, William Pye who was born in either Maryland or Barbados. I can find no definite answers but have lots of opinions from others.

If you can lead me to any records of the late 1700's I would be ever grateful.
